Book Review: The Cop Guy: A SoCal Novel by Mark Barkawitz

  



 
 
The Cop Guy: A SoCal Novel by Mark Barkawitz
This book starts out with  Michael and he's got his hands full.
A pregnant girlfriend Bonnie, a runaway woman, Emily that is involved in testifying at a court trial about cartel drugs, tennis coach, baseball pitcher, FBI asking questions of him, Mike is just trying to live. He lives at a woman's house who he housesits for, cleaning out her garage and gets the ex husbands car running. Mike also sells his old baseball cards to make ends meet.
Robert shooting a gun at baseball game, the scenes go on. 
At times the scenes are funny but they  are also very dire.
Love the very descriptive details, this would make a really good movie! Like how he earns his money, almost something for him and he finds them. He has many colorful friends and work connections. He has so much going against him and then he falls off the roof.
Love male point of view, no frilly or flowery things.
Amazing how all these connection to Mike and he can wrap it up so quickly with no cliff hangers.
Can't wait to read more from this author.
